Logging in: Regular User Mode
Depending on the authentication mode and the specified user name, the following
authentication process is performed for login authentication.
For users registered in the LDAP server
Specify a user name from the user information registered with the LDAP server.
When the [Server Type] of the LDAP server is [Active Directory] or [Active
Directory Global Catalog]
When the [Server Type] of the LDAP server is [Other LDAP Server]
